Official abstract text for this publication.
A steering device for a vehicle includes: a rail provided on a crash pad of the vehicle; a base unit engaged to the rail to be movable along the rail; a steering unit coupled to the base unit and configured to adjust a moving direction of the vehicle; and a controller operatively connected to the base unit and the steering unit and configured to adjust at least one of a position of the base unit and a tilting angle of the steering unit.
Opening claim text (preview).
What is claimed is: 1 . A steering apparatus for a vehicle, the steering apparatus comprising: a rail provided on a crash pad of the vehicle; a base unit engaged to the rail to be movable along the rail; a steering unit coupled to the base unit and configured to adjust a moving direction of the vehicle; and a controller operatively connected to the base unit and the steering unit and configured to adjust at least one of a position of the base unit and a tilting angle of the steering unit. 2 . The steering ap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the steering unit includes: a steering wheel configured to adjust the moving direction of the vehicle; and a steering column coupled to the base unit to interconnect the steering wheel and the base unit. 3 . The steering apparatus of claim 2 , wherein the steering wheel includes, on a rear surface of the steering wheel, at least one of a lamp configured to emit light and a speaker configured to emit sound. 4 . The steering apparatus of claim 3 , wherein the steering wheel includes, on a front surface of the steering wheel, a touch sensor configured to control ON/OFF of the lamp. 5 . The steering apparatus of claim 4 , wherein the controller electrically connected to the touch sensor is configured to determine whether a driver is holding the steering wheel in response that the vehicle is in a semi-autonomous driving mode. 6 . The steering apparatus of claim 3 , wherein the lamp is in plural and in response that the vehicle changes lanes or turns left or right, the controller is further configured to blink a lamp located in a corresponding direction among the plurality of lamps. 7 . The steering apparatus of claim 3 , wherein, in response that the vehicle is determined to be in an emergency situation, including crossing a center line or unintentionally changing lanes, the controller is further configured to emit sound at a frequency that causes vibration in the steering wheel. 8 . The steering apparatus of claim 2 , wherein the steering wheel includes, in a center of a front surface of the steering wheel, a holder on which a user communication terminal configured to communicate with the vehicle is mounted. 9 . The steering apparatus of claim 8 , wherein the holder is provided with a wireless charging system therein to wirelessly charge the user communication terminal in a state that the mounted user communication terminal supports wireless charging. 10 . The steering apparatus of claim 8 , wherein the user communication terminal mounted on the holder is configured to display vehicle status information including a vehicle speed, a capacity of a battery mounted on the vehicle, or a fuel residual amount. 11 . The steering apparatus of claim 1 , further including a steer-by-wire (SBW) system, wherein the base unit includes a first connector, the steering unit includes a second connector, the first connector and the second connector are connected to each other to electrically interconnect the base unit and the steering unit, and the first connector is configured to transmit a steering signal generated from the steering unit, to the SBW system. 12 . The steering ap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the base unit includes a sliding motor engaged to the rail and configured to move the base unit along the rail. 13 . The steering ap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the steering unit or the base unit includes a tilting motor engaged to the steering unit and configured to adjust the tilting angle of the steering unit. 14 . The steering ap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the steering unit or the base unit includes a telescopic motor engaged to the steering unit and configured to adjust a length of the steering unit in a predetermined direction. 15 . The steering apparatus of claim 1 , wherein, in response that the vehicle is in an autonomous driving mode, the controller is further configured to slide the base unit along the rail away from the driver. 16 . The steering apparatus of claim 1 , wherein, in response of switching the vehicle from an autonomous driving mode to a manual driving mode or canceling the autonomous driving mode, the controller is further configured to slide the base unit along the rail toward the driver. 17 . The steering apparatus of claim 1 , wherein, during an internal mode, the controller is further configured to control a lamp provided on a rear surface of the steering wheel included in the steering unit to emit light toward the crash pad, or a speaker mounted on the rear surface of the steering wheel to emit sound. 18 . The steering apparatus of claim 1 , wherein, during a content watching mode, an angle between the base unit and the steering unit is 90 degrees or less than the 90 degrees, and the controller is further configured to slide the base unit along the rail to be spaced from a driver with a predetermined distance. 19 . The steering ap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the steering unit is configured to be attached to or detached from the base unit and to be provided at a plurality of points within the vehicle. 20 . The steering apparatus of claim 19 , wherein the base unit is configured so that a plurality of accessories including a cup holder configured to be heated or refrigerated are attached to or detached from the base unit.
